> eDP spec states that when sink enconters a problem that prevents it
> to keep PSR running it should set PSR status to internal error and
> set the reason why it happen to PSR_ERROR_STATUS but it is not how it
> was implemented.
> But also I don't want to change this behavior, who knows if there is
> a panel out there that only set the PSR_ERROR_STATUS.
> 
> So here refactoring the code a bit to make more easy to read what was
> state above as more checks will be added to this function.
